WebReading Borough Council WebThis first version of the LCWIP focuses on routes in Newbury and Thatcham. Eastern area settlements, such as Calcot, Pangbourne, Purley-on-Thames and Theale, have already been covered in the Reading LCWIP , which was prepared jointly with Reading Borough Council and Wokingham Borough Council, and adopted in 2024.
WebDeveloping an LCWIP will help an authority make a strong case for future investment in active travel infrastructure. DfT has produced guidance and tools on developing an LCWIP .
